Description

This 1977 Topps football card features Cincinnati Bengals' Safety Tommy Casanova, celebrating his 1976 AFC All-Pro selection. The card face uses the iconic 1977 'banner and football' design with a pink team banner and a profile shot of Casanova in his vintage Bengals helmet. It is a classic piece of mid-70s gridiron history.

Selling Guide

Where to Sell

eBay (using eBay Standard Envelope for low-cost shipping) or COMC (Check Out My Cards) for long-term inventory placement.

Selling Tips

Do not grade this card; the grading fees will far outweigh the market value. Use 'PWE' (Plain White Envelope) shipping to keep costs low for buyers. Title the listing with '1977 Topps Tommy Casanova #379 Bengals All-Pro'.
